Transaction 341efd73b9f7b3c705db63a2a532afdefe25300e4f5245e3ebb90bfbc25e7500

2 Input
2 Outputs
  • 341efd73b9f7b3c705db63a2a532afdefe25300e4f5245e3ebb90bfbc25e7500:0
  • value  9593100
    address  16aUyzvUPCDUHUBDHJjA12NujFHULTS4Mb
  • 341efd73b9f7b3c705db63a2a532afdefe25300e4f5245e3ebb90bfbc25e7500:1
  • value  29724897
    address  3DzDrdjLGLu49B18ngzgUpGTeTkj5qvwkm